English noun: cistern | |||
1. | cistern (body) a sac or cavity containing fluid especially lymph or cerebrospinal fluid | ||
Synonyms | cisterna | ||
Broader (hypernym) | sac | ||
2. | cistern (artifact) a tank that holds the water used to flush a toilet | ||
Synonyms | water tank | ||
Broader (hypernym) | storage tank, tank | ||
3. | cistern (artifact) an artificial reservoir for storing liquids; especially an underground tank for storing rainwater | ||
Broader (hypernym) | pool, reservoir | ||
Narrower (hyponym) | cesspit, cesspool, rain barrel, sink, sump | ||
